数据库索引策略

数据库索引策略

💡 原文英文,约1600词,阅读约需6分钟。
📝

内容提要

本文探讨了有效的数据库索引策略,包括索引的作用、结构和设计原则。良好设计的索引是实现高效数据库和应用程序性能的关键。

🎯

关键要点

  • 本文探讨了有效的数据库索引策略,强调索引在数据库性能中的重要性。
  • 良好设计的索引是实现高效数据库和应用程序性能的关键。
  • 索引是加速数据检索操作的数据结构,类似于书籍末尾的索引。
  • 数据库索引的结构包括有序值列表,每个值连接到指向数据页的指针。
  • 索引通常存储在磁盘上,使用B+树结构以提高数据检索效率。
  • 找到合适的索引需要在快速查询响应和更新成本之间取得平衡。
  • B+树是一种广泛用于数据库索引的树形数据结构,其特点是数据指针仅存储在叶节点。
  • 聚集索引重新排列表中记录的物理存储方式,通常只能有一个聚集索引。
  • 非聚集索引与数据行分开存储,允许在表上有多个非聚集索引以支持不同查询。
  • 主索引通常是访问数据的主要方式,主键通常作为聚集索引使用以加速数据检索。
➡️

继续阅读